If you park any Omega for more than a week without disconnecting the battery*, expect to have to jump it.

But, do this more than four or five times, and you can expect to be buying a new battery.

* The caveat is to be sure that the key works in the driver's door lock and do not double lock it with the remote...
Most Standard Elites can easily withstand 3-4 weeks if all is in good working order, and the power sounder is in the bin. Lesser models should be a little bit better.

PS4's are great value for money, for their grip, durability, noise level and overall good characteristics when on an Omega they outperform every other tyre I've had on an Omega, if it weren't for the noise the only tyre something like equal to them in my mind would be the Dunlop SportMaxx TT... until they fall off the planet when 2/3rds worn
